A public sector recruitment agency is seeking a Clerk of Works in Motherwell, Scotland. This role involves overseeing housing regeneration projects by ensuring quality monitoring from start to finish, conducting audits, and preparing reports.
Candidates should have experience in similar roles, possess a clean driving licence, and be IT literate. This position falls under IR35 regulations, offering a contract-based role in a significant local authority with ambitious long-term housing plans.
